What is the Zip, Desiring To Execute A LIMITED POWER OF ATTORNEY, Hereby Appoint,
The Zip, Desiring To Execute A LIMITED POWER OF ATTORNEY, Hereby Appoint, form is a legal document that grants specific powers to an appointed individual, known as the agent or attorney-in-fact. This form allows the principal to designate someone to act on their behalf in particular matters, such as financial transactions or legal decisions, while retaining control over other aspects of their affairs. The limited power of attorney is particularly useful for individuals who may be unable to manage their affairs due to travel, illness, or other circumstances.
How to use the Zip, Desiring To Execute A LIMITED POWER OF ATTORNEY, Hereby Appoint,
To effectively use the Zip, Desiring To Execute A LIMITED POWER OF ATTORNEY, Hereby Appoint, form, begin by clearly defining the scope of authority granted to the agent. Specify the tasks the agent is allowed to perform, which can include managing bank accounts, signing documents, or handling real estate transactions. Ensure that both the principal and the agent understand the terms outlined in the document. Once completed, the form must be signed by the principal and may require notarization, depending on state laws.

Key elements of the Zip, Desiring To Execute A LIMITED POWER OF ATTORNEY, Hereby Appoint,
Several key elements must be included in the Zip, Desiring To Execute A LIMITED POWER OF ATTORNEY, Hereby Appoint, form to ensure its validity:
- The full names and addresses of the principal and the agent.
- A clear statement of the powers granted to the agent.
- The duration of the power of attorney, if applicable.
- Signatures of the principal and the agent, along with the date of signing.
- Notarization, if required by state law.
